The Real Impact of Viewer Bots on Stream Quality

In the world of streaming, viewer engagement is crucial. But what happens when viewer bots enter the scene? These automated programs can artificially inflate viewer counts, but at what cost? The impact of viewer bots on stream quality can be profound and multifaceted. First, let’s consider the content creators. They put in countless hours crafting their streams, hoping to connect with real audiences. However, when bots skew the numbers, it can create a false sense of achievement. Imagine pouring your heart into a performance only to find out that many of your viewers are not even real. It’s like throwing a party and realizing most of the guests are cardboard cutouts.

Moreover, viewer bots can dilute the interaction that is so vital to the streaming experience. When a streamer engages with their audience, they thrive on genuine feedback and real-time reactions. But if the chat is filled with bot-generated comments, it can feel empty and lifeless. This lack of authenticity can lead to disillusionment for both creators and viewers. The energy of a stream can shift dramatically when the audience feels more like a number than a community.

The effects extend beyond just the creators. For viewers, it can be frustrating to tune into a stream that claims to have thousands of viewers but feels devoid of interaction. They might wonder, “Where is everyone?” This can lead to a decrease in viewer loyalty. If the experience feels artificial, many may choose to seek out streams that offer genuine engagement.

So, how do viewer bots affect the overall streaming experience? Here are a few key points to consider:

  • Inflated Metrics: Viewer bots can create misleading statistics that misrepresent a stream’s popularity.
  • Reduced Interaction: Real viewers may feel less inclined to engage if they sense an artificial atmosphere.
  • Trust Issues: Both viewers and creators might become skeptical of stream metrics, leading to a lack of trust in the platform.

In conclusion, while viewer bots may seem harmless or even beneficial at first glance, their impact on stream quality is anything but. They can undermine the authenticity of the streaming experience, leaving both creators and viewers feeling disconnected. In the end, genuine connection beats inflated numbers any day.
